Emma Lena (Parola) Vlasich of Gillespie, 102, died on Sunday, Aug. 13, 2023, at 8:40 a.m. at Gillespie Health and Rehab Center.

Visitation will be held from 10 to 11 a.m. on Saturday, Sept. 9, at SS Simon and Jude Church in Gillespie. There will be a  memorial Mass  following at 11 a.m. at the church. Inurnment will be at Holy Cross Cemetery in Gillespie. Kravanya Funeral Home in Gillespie is assisting the family with arrangements.

Mrs. Vlasich was born on Sept. 13, 1920, in Taylor Springs, the daughter of James and Maddalena (Davito) Parola. She married Henry Vlasich on Oct. 13, 1940, and he preceded her in death on Nov. 15, 2004.

Mrs. Vlasich worked as a legal secretary and a secretary for SS Simon and Jude Church in Gillespie before she retired. She was defined by her church, beauty and cooking expertise. A devout Catholic, she practiced her religion faithfully.

Twice a queen, Mrs. Vlasich was crowned the Hillsboro High School Homecoming Queen in 1937, the first Italian girl from Taylor Springs to do so. She was later crowned queen for the annual Canna Anna civic organization festival in 1955, which was held every summer in Gillespie.

She was recognized by everyone as a gourmet chef, and eating at her table was a memorable experience that was shared by all her friends and family.

She is survived by her sons, Henry Daniel (Suzanne) Vlasich of Arizona and James (Grace) Vlasich of Colorado; grandchildren, Daniel Christopher Vlasich and Brooke Vlasich both of California and Ming (Danny) Scheid of Colorado.

In addition to her husband, she was preceded in death by her parents .
